 EARLY CHILDHOOD PROGRAMS

 

Temple Beth Chai offers “FREE” fun, educational programs to the community to supplement your young child’s secular education. Our programs promote each child's identification with Jewish culture through stories, crafts, games, and songs providing experiences which will help to develop warmth in Jewish customs and holiday celebrations. Our activities will also familiarize your child with the synagogue and the Rabbi.
